#COVID19: UK Churches Deliver Sunday Services to Mass Audiences Over the Internet
The latest available figures show 5,018 recorded coronavirus cases in the UK. So far, 233 people have died of the virus in the country.
Normally busy areas including London's Oxford Street have fallen quiet as bars, theatres and restaurants close across the UK.
Churches across the UK prepared to deliver Sunday services to mass audiences over the internet as part of their efforts to fight the coronavirus
Boris Johnson urged people not to visit their parents on Mother’s Day, as he warned the UK that the spread of coronavirus is "accelerating"
